Transaction 9d5731204516183dbaec0a150e3fc475c8161508511093cd748c3791c95f602e

1 Input
2 Outputs
  • 9d5731204516183dbaec0a150e3fc475c8161508511093cd748c3791c95f602e:0
  • value  1132573
    address  3Dz9bAWp4RxJxbsMMvNi6RH3BLd2t8wVmW
  • 9d5731204516183dbaec0a150e3fc475c8161508511093cd748c3791c95f602e:1
  • value  2660
    address  1NYzdGH8VkuNXKUbaEoc55n6EQRCwtna5A